word problem: Bonnie wants to paint a circle on a wall in her bedroom. The height of the wall is 8 feet, from floor to ceiling. She wants the circle to be 1 foot away from the floor and 1 foot away from the ceiling. What is the radius of the circle she will paint? What is the area of the circle? What is the circumference of the circle?

|dw:1367970614048:dw| You can see that the radius "r" is half of the diameter "d". You also can figure out the diameter by subtracting one foot from the bottom and one foot from the top to the total 8ft. This written out should be:\[r=\frac{ d }{ 2 }=\frac{ 8ft-1ft-1ft }{ 2 }=3ft\]Now to find the area you can use the following equation:\[A=\pi r ^{2}=\pi (3ft)^{2}=9\pi ft ^{2}\]Finally the circumference can be found through:\[C=2 \pi r=2\pi 3ft=6\pi ft\]
